Document Description
The applicant, John Grizzle has requested that the zone designation of the above referenced parcels be changed from A-2-R (General Agriculture/non-residential) to A-3 (Heavy Agriculture). Currently Grizzle Farms operates a cattle feeding operation within a portion (about half of the area) of this area which was permitted by special use permit (#472-80). The change would increase the amount of A-3 land in the county by 1,147 acres or to view it another way, it changes 1147 acres from A-2 to A-3.
